This thesis analyzes, designs and tests circuit topologies for simultaneous energy harvesting from solar and 915-MHz RF energy sources. An important design objective is to minimize system weight while maximizing output power and operating time for applications in the sub-170-mg and single-mW ranges. The resulting energy harvesting system uses a unique approach of categorizing the harvesters as primary and auxiliary harvesters due to the power levels of each in relation to the high load demand. This work results in a 162-mg supercapacitor-powered system capable of powering a 2-V load at up to approximately 2-3 mW and a 150-mg battery-powered system capable of powering a 2-V load at up to 6 mW. The auxiliary RF harvester uses a fully-integrated charge pump to impedance-match to a rectenna with greater than 94% matching. The parasitic models developed for the RF harvester show errors less than 1.4% in the measured system.

Testo completoConcrete with smart and functional properties (e.g., self-sensing, self-healing, and energy-harvesting) represents a transformative direction in the field of construction materials. Energy-harvesting concrete has the capability to store or convert the ambient energy (e.g., light, thermal, and mechanical energy) for feasible uses, alleviating global energy and pollution problems as well as reducing carbon footprint. The employment of energy-harvesting concrete can endow infrastructures (e.g., buildings, railways, and highways) with energy self-sufficiency, effectively promoting sustainable infrastructure development. This paper provides a systematic overview on the principles, fabrication, properties, and applications of energy-harvesting concrete (including light-emitting, thermal-storing, thermoelectric, pyroelectric, and piezoelectric concretes). The paper concludes with an outline of some future challenges and opportunities in the application of energy-harvesting concrete in sustainable infrastructures.

Testo completoThe intent of this research is to draw attention to linear generators and their potential uses. A flexible model of a linear generator created in MATLAB Simulink is presented. The model is a three-phase, 12-pole, non-salient, synchronous permanent magnet linear generator with a non-sinusoidal back electromotive force (EMF) but could easily be adapted to fit any number of poles or any back EMF waveform. The emerging technologies related to linear generators such as wave energy converters and free-piston engines are explained. A selection of these technologies is generically modeled and their results are discussed and contrasted against one another. The model clearly demonstrates the challenges of using linear generators in different scenarios. It also proves itself a useful tool in analyzing and improving the performance of linear generators under a variety of circumstances.

Singlet exciton fission transforms a single molecular excited state into two excited states of half the energy. When used in solar cells it can double the photocurrent from high energy photons increasing the maximum theoretical power efficiency to greater than 40%. The steady state singlet fission rate can be perturbed under an external magnetic field. I utilize this effect to monitor the yield of singlet fission within operating solar cells. Singlet fission approaches unity efficiency in the organic semiconductor pentacene for layers more than 5 nm thick. Using organic solar cells as a model system for extracting photocurrent from singlet fission, I exceed the convention limit of 1 electron per photon, realizing 1.26 electrons per incident photon. One device architecture proposed for high power efficiency singlet fission solar cells coats a conventional inorganic semiconducting solar with a singlet fission molecule. This design requires energy transfer from the non-emissive triplet exciton to the semiconducting material, a process which has not been demonstrated. I prove that colloidal nanocrystals accept triplet excitons from the singlet fission molecule tetracene. This enables future devices where the combine singlet fission material and nanocrystal system energy transfer triplet excitons produced by singlet fission to a silicon solar cell.
